What is a Mini Yorkshire Terrier?
The Mini Yorkshire Terrier is a smaller sized variation of the standard Yorkshire Terrier, which generally weighs 4 to 7 pounds. These tiny dogs typically weigh in between 2 to 4 pounds and stand about 6 to 7 inches high. This diminutive size makes them an exceptional choice for apartment or condo occupants and those with limited area. Despite their small stature, Mini Yorkies have huge characters and are frequently identified as spirited, caring, and spirited.

Health Considerations
While Mini Yorkshire Terrier Mini Kaufen Terriers are generally healthy, they can be vulnerable to specific health problems. Awareness and preventive care can mitigate a lot of these dangers.
Health IssueDescriptionOral ProblemsSmall mouths can lead to overcrowded teeth; routine dental care is essential.Patellar LuxationA common concern in small breeds where the kneecap dislocates. Regular veterinarian check-ups can help capture this early.HypoglycemiaLow blood sugar is particularly crucial in small types; preserving a routine feeding schedule is vital.Collapsing TracheaA condition typically seen in small types, resulting in coughing and breathing difficulties.
